Personal Details and Bio Data
Full Name | Broderick Stephen Harvey |
Born | January 17, 1957 |
Birthplace | Welch, West Virginia, U.S. |
Occupation | Comedian, Television Host, Radio Personality, Actor, Author, Businessman |
Years Active | 1985–present |
Spouse(s) | Marcia Harvey (m. 1980; div. 1994) Mary Shackelford (m. 1996; div. 2005) Marjorie Bridges (m. 2007) |
Children | 7 (including stepchildren) |
The Early Days of Stand-Up
Steve Harvey began his comedy career in the mid-1980s. He performed in small clubs. It was a tough start, you know, with lots of travel.
He faced homelessness at one point. He lived in his car for a time. This period shows his determination, it really does.
He kept going, despite the difficulties. He believed in his ability to make people laugh. This belief was a strong motivator, obviously.
His style of comedy connected with audiences. He talked about everyday life and relationships. People found his observations quite relatable, you know.
He built a loyal following slowly. He worked hard on his routines. This laid the groundwork for bigger things, it really did.
Breaking Through: The Kings of Comedy
The "Kings of Comedy" tour was a major turning point. It brought together four top comedians. Steve Harvey was one of them, of course.
The tour became a huge success. It sold out arenas across the country. This really put him on a bigger stage, so to speak.
The film "The Original Kings of Comedy" came out in 2000. It captured the live performances. This movie introduced him to an even wider audience, you know.
This exposure increased his fame significantly. It opened up many new doors for him. People started seeing him as a major entertainment force, obviously.
His comedic timing and stage presence shone through. He was a crowd favorite. This success was a big boost for his career, it really was.

Bestselling Author: Writing His Way to More
Steve Harvey also became a successful author. His book, "Act Like a Lady, Think Like a Man," was a huge hit. It sold millions of copies, you know.
The book offered relationship advice. It resonated with many readers. This turned into a whole new income source for him, it really did.
The book's popularity led to a film adaptation. "Think Like a Man" was also very successful. This extended his reach even further, so to speak.
He wrote other books too. They also did quite well. Being an author added another layer to his financial picture, you know.
Book sales and movie rights contribute significantly. They are a passive income stream, in a way. This shows his ability to diversify his talents, obviously.
Family Feud: A Major Income Stream
Hosting "Family Feud" is perhaps his most recognizable role today. He took over the show in 2010. It quickly gained huge popularity, you know.
His reactions and humor made the show a hit. He brought a fresh energy to it. Viewers really enjoy his personality, they do.
The show airs multiple times a day in syndication. This means a steady and substantial paycheck for him. It is a very consistent source of money, so to speak.
He records many episodes in a short time. This makes his work on the show quite efficient. It allows him to pursue other projects, you know.
His contract for "Family Feud" is likely quite large. It is a major component of his overall net worth. This show truly solidified his financial standing, obviously.

The Talk Show Era
Steve Harvey also hosted his own daytime talk show. "Steve Harvey" ran from 2012 to 2017. It was another platform for him, you know.
He offered advice, interviewed guests, and did comedy. The show had a loyal viewership. It showcased his ability to connect with people, it really did.
Later, he launched "Steve," a new talk show. This one had a different format. It aimed for a more casual feel, so to speak.
While the talk shows eventually ended, they added to his wealth. They kept him in the public eye. They were important stepping stones, you know.

Philanthropy and Giving Back
Steve Harvey also uses his wealth for good. He established the Steve & Marjorie Harvey Foundation. It helps young people, you know.
The foundation provides mentoring and educational programs. It aims to empower future generations. This work is very important to him, it really is.
He hosts events to raise money for his causes. He gives back to communities. This shows a commitment beyond just making money, so to speak.
